How to Style Natural Wavy Hair
Styling natural wavy hair involves techniques that enhance your waves' natural texture and volume, minimizing heat damage. The key is to work with your hair's natural pattern, not against it.
Start with the right foundation. Use a gentle, moisturizing shampoo and conditioner designed for wavy hair to avoid stripping away natural oils. Limit shampooing to avoid dryness; consider co-washing (conditioning only) some washes.
Enhancing Your Waves
Several techniques help define and boost your waves:
- Scrunching: This is a fundamental technique. Gently scrunch your wet hair upwards to encourage wave formation. As noted, scrunching helps "enhance loose textures".
- Plopping: Wrap your wet, scrunched hair in a microfiber towel or t-shirt for 15-30 minutes to absorb excess water and encourage curl definition. This "encourages wave formation," per one source.

- Air Drying: For a low-heat approach, allow your hair to air dry completely after scrunching and plopping. Air drying is a recommended heat-free styling option.
Product Application
The right products significantly impact your wavy hair's style:
- Leave-in Conditioner: Apply a lightweight leave-in conditioner to add moisture and definition. - Styling Creams or Gels: Consider styling creams or gels for hold and definition, selecting a product appropriate for your hair's thickness and texture. Light textures like mousse or liquid gel work for refreshing waves. A source mentions these options for refreshing waves.
- Oils: Argan or olive oil can add shine and moisture, particularly to the ends, but use sparingly to avoid oiliness. This is mentioned as a strategy for managing hair on days 3 or 4.
